Inspection & Maintenance of City Stormwater Facilities
  • Department: Public Works
  • RFP Number: RFP-2026-036
  • Start Date: 06/02/2026
  • Close Date: 07/09/2026 5:00 PM

The City of Gaithersburg Department of Public Works Environmental Services Division intends to enter into a firm-fixed price, indefinite-quantity, unit-price Contract with one qualified Contractor to service, inspect, maintain, and repair City-maintained stormwater management infrastructure throughout the City.
